Spry Collapsible Panel
A Spry Collapsible Panel is, in a sense, a single accordion panel. The same style of layout is used with the
label placed in the full-width top tab and, when clicked, it collapses or expands. Because there is no other
associated panel, only the tab remains when the panel collapses. The panel can either be open or closed
when the page is initially displayed.
To add a Spry Collapsible Panel widget to your page, follow these steps:
1. Place your cursor where you??™d like your menu bar to appear.
2. From the Insert bar??™s Spry or Layout category, choose Spry Collapsible Panel Bar. The default collapsible
panel is inserted into the page and the custom Property inspector (see Figure 18-27) displays.
3. To set the panel to be open when the page loads, choose Open from the Default State list; to set
the panel to be collapsed, choose Closed.
As with the other widgets, the first time you save a file with a Spry Collapsible Panel widget,
Dreamweaver tells you of the supporting files that have been copied to your site and will
need to be posted online. The Spry Collapsible Panel widget relies on two supporting files:
SpryCollapsiblePanels.js and SpryCollapsiblePanels.css.
